Nettet2. jun. 2024 · Key Points. We estimate that each new preschooler for a universal pre-K program requires about $21,000 in new construction costs for facilities expansion. Nettet28. jul. 2024 · The Universal Child Care and Early Learning Act would establish universal pre-K on a federal level. Specifically, it would aim to make the cost of childcare free for families earning up to 200 percent of the federal poverty line, while capping the cost for families above that level at 7 percent of their household income.
